It works by mimicking the action of a natural hormone in the body called gl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1). This hormone plays a crucial role in glucose metabolism, promoting insulin secretion when blood sugar levels are high and reducing the amount of glucose released by the liver.<\/p>\n<p>In addition to its primary use for diabetes management, Ozempic has gained popularity for its weight loss effects. Patients have reported significant weight loss while using the medication, which has prompted some healthcare providers to consider it as a potential option for obesity management. However, while Ozempic can be effective, it does come with its share of side effects\u2014some of which can be severe.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"section3\"><span data-mce-fragment=\"1\">Common Side Effects of Ozempic<\/span><\/h2>\n<h3>Gastrointestinal Issues<\/h3>\n<p>One of the most commonly reported side effects of Ozempic involves gastrointestinal (GI) symptoms. These include: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Nausea<\/strong>: This is often the most prevalent side effect, affecting approximately 20% of users, particularly upon initiation or dose escalation.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Diarrhea<\/strong>: Around 8% of individuals may experience diarrhea, which can be uncomfortable but typically subsides within a week.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Vomiting<\/strong>: Occurs in about 10% of users and can be linked to the drug&#8217;s effects on gastric emptying.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Abdominal pain<\/strong>: Some users report discomfort, cramping, or bloating, with around 7% experiencing these symptoms.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>It\u2019s important to note that while these symptoms are common, they are usually mild to moderate and may improve over time as the body adjusts to the medication.<\/p>\n<h3>Injection Site Reactions<\/h3>\n<p>Some users may experience localized reactions at the injection site, including: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Redness<\/li>\n<li>Swelling<\/li>\n<li>Pain<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>These reactions are generally mild and resolve without the need for medical intervention.<\/p>\n<h3>Changes in Appetite<\/h3>\n<p>Many individuals report a significant reduction in appetite while using Ozempic. While this can be beneficial for weight loss, it may lead to unintentional malnutrition if not monitored closely. Those using Ozempic should ensure they are still getting adequate nutrition, possibly with additional supplementation as needed.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"section4\"><span data-mce-fragment=\"1\">Serious Side Effects of Ozempic<\/span><\/h2>\n<p>While most side effects are manageable, it\u2019s crucial to be aware of the more serious risks associated with Ozempic.<\/p>\n<h3>Pancreatitis<\/h3>\n<p>Pancreatitis, or inflammation of the pancreas, is a significant concern for users of Ozempic. Although instances are rare, they can be severe and require immediate medical attention. Symptoms may include: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Severe abdominal pain<\/li>\n<li>Nausea and vomiting<\/li>\n<li>Fever<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>If you experience these symptoms, it\u2019s essential to seek medical help promptly.<\/p>\n<h3>Thyroid Tumors<\/h3>\n<p>Ozempic has been associated with an increased risk of thyroid tumors in animal studies, leading to a boxed warning from the FDA. While the risk in humans is still being studied, individuals with a family history of thyroid cancer or multiple endocrine neoplasia syndrome type 2 should consult their healthcare provider before starting Ozempic.<\/p>\n<h3>Kidney Issues<\/h3>\n<p>Reports have emerged linking Ozempic to kidney injury, particularly in patients who experience severe gastrointestinal side effects leading to dehydration. Kidney function should be monitored in patients taking Ozempic, especially if they have pre-existing kidney conditions.<\/p>\n<h3>Vision Changes<\/h3>\n<p>Some users may experience changes in vision due to fluctuations in blood sugar levels. Rapid changes can lead to blurred vision or other eye issues, prompting a discussion with your healthcare provider if these symptoms arise.<\/p>\n<h3>Hypoglycemia<\/h3>\n<p>While Ozempic primarily helps to lower blood sugar levels, there is a risk of hypoglycemia (low blood sugar), particularly when taken in conjunction with other diabetes medications. Symptoms of hypoglycemia include: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Sweating<\/li>\n<li>Shakiness<\/li>\n<li>Confusion<\/li>\n<li>Dizziness<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>If you notice any of these symptoms, it\u2019s essential to contact your healthcare provider.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"section5\"><span data-mce-fragment=\"1\">Long-Term Effects of Ozempic<\/span><\/h2>\n<h3>Gallbladder Disease<\/h3>\n<p>Research suggests that long-term use of Ozempic may increase the risk of gallstones and gallbladder disease. If you experience symptoms such as abdominal pain or jaundice, it\u2019s crucial to seek medical advice.<\/p>\n<h3>Gastroparesis<\/h3>\n<p>Gastroparesis, a condition where the stomach cannot empty properly, can occur as a result of Ozempic\u2019s effects on gastric motility. Symptoms may include: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Nausea<\/li>\n<li>Vomiting<\/li>\n<li>Early satiety<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>If you suspect gastroparesis, consult your healthcare provider for evaluation and management options.<\/p>\n<h3>Mental Health Considerations<\/h3>\n<p>As with many medications that affect appetite and digestion, there is a potential psychological impact. Chronic digestive issues can lead to anxiety, stress, and even depression. It\u2019s vital to be aware of how your mental health may be influenced while on Ozempic and communicate any concerns with your healthcare team.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"section6\"><span data-mce-fragment=\"1\">Managing Side Effects of Ozempic<\/span><\/h2>\n<p>While side effects can be concerning, there are strategies to manage them effectively:<\/p>\n<ol>\n<li><strong>Start Low, Go Slow<\/strong>: Initiating treatment at a lower dose and gradually increasing can help your body adjust more comfortably.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Stay Hydrated<\/strong>: Drinking plenty of fluids can help mitigate some gastrointestinal side effects.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Nutrition Monitoring<\/strong>: Pay attention to your diet to ensure you\u2019re meeting your nutritional needs, especially if appetite suppression is significant.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Regular Check-Ups<\/strong>: Frequent consultations with your healthcare provider can help monitor for serious side effects and adjust treatment as necessary.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<h2 id=\"section7\"><span data-mce-fragment=\"1\">TrimRx&#8217;s Commitment to Your Health Journey<\/span><\/h2>\n<p>At TrimRx, we understand that embarking on a weight loss journey can be daunting, especially when considering medications like Ozempic.
